The El Sobrante Art Guild is a non-profit organization (501c3) that was started in the late 1960s as an avenue for artists to get together. In 1973 the Guild became involved in promoting the Arts within our local school district. This is done through cash awards that are given at the Annual Student Awards Show for The West Contra Costa Unified School District at the Richmond Art Center. This coming year will be our 36th year of supporting our local teachers and helping aspiring young artists to succeed in the medium of their choice. Each of the last few years, we have been able to award over $2,000 annually which is divided between student prizes and classroom materials.
Our largest fund-raiser of the year is the Christmas Shop where artisan members sell their hand-made arts and crafts during November and December. Ten percent of all sales at the Christmas Shop are donated for this program. At our Christmas Shop we also sell donation tickets. These tickets are placed in a drawing for prizes that have been donated by the Art Guild members, Community Members and Businesses to support the program.
